    What happened

    Construction of the new bridge connecting Sheikh Zayed Road to Dubai Harbour is currently 90% complete. This infrastructure project is designed to significantly reduce travel time from 12 minutes to just 3 minutes. The bridge is expected to enhance connectivity in the region, making it easier for commuters and commercial traffic to access the harbour.

    Managed by the Roads and Transport Authority (RTA), the project is part of Dubai's ongoing efforts to improve its infrastructure. With the completion date anticipated in mid-2026, the bridge is set to play a vital role in the city's transportation landscape.
